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for hosts and hostesses, restaurant, lounge, and coffee shop in the industry of hospitals - local government owned.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) hosts and hostesses, restaurant, lounge, and coffee shop is $32,960.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$24,050.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ent hosts and hostesses, restaurant, lounge, and coffee shop is $19,810.
